How they compare

El Salvador currently reports 1.09 modelled data against 1.09 modelled data in Ghana, a difference of 0 modelled data.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Ghana ahead.

El Salvador ranks 45th and Ghana ranks 46th of 164 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, El Salvador averaged higher in 2 and Ghana in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ade El Salvador Ghana Difference Ahead
1980s 0.703 modelled data 0.6873 modelled data 0.0157 modelled data El Salvador
1990s 0.8052 modelled data 0.7696 modelled data 0.0356 modelled data El Salvador
2000s 0.9082 modelled data 0.9445 modelled data 0.0362 modelled data Ghana
2010s 1.03 modelled data 1.05 modelled data 0.0144 modelled data Ghana
2020s 1.08 modelled data 1.08 modelled data 0.0017 modelled data Ghana

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
